Cael spoke for a few minutes, but most of the presentation came from Clay. Focus was on requesting donations, especially reoccurring donations. $12/month was the basic level and on up. Clay stated if you want to help with an individual's NIL or a scholarship, shoot him an email. cms5406@psu.edu
He stated several times that our recruits and team members are trying to be being lured away by other teams with money.

Clay said in the webinar that donations directly to PSU or to the PSWC or the NLWC will be doubled. Not clear if you pledge a monthly donation whether just the donation during the Olympics will be doubled if you do that. It was very vague on how they would determine the total amount donated. As a for instance if they want to know the amount donated to the PSWC during that period they have to ask me for the number and no one has contacted me at all.
